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Electrical Supplies, Nec in 80216 Denver, CO
2 businesses found
Innovative Power Systems Inc
7003 East 47th Avenue Drive # 1200 , 80216
Phone:
(303) 377-6300
Crum Electric Supply Co Inc
6260 Washington St # 22 , 80216
Phone:
(303) 429-1842